The recipe in my OP was too specific, the problem occurs even without
term-previous-input:
1. emacs -Q
2. M-x term RET
3. C-c 2
4. RET
=> Cursor jumps from the term prompt to the beginning of the buffer
I instrumented term.el but could not induce the jump when stepping
through with edebug. I don't know how else to try debugging this.
